What year R6 is fastest?

The 2008 model year had the highest power-weight ratio of any other R6, even to today. It doesn't mean they're the best, but it's some kind of bragging right! More power with 95kW (127 hp) @ 14,500 rpm — actually the most powerful the R6 ever was, by a few kW!

Is the R6 a good beginner bike?

The R6 is not the best choice for beginner motorcycle riders. With a powerful engine, uncomfortable ergonomics, and a high price, the Yamaha R6 is a high-performance racer bike that can be a lot to handle for most inexperienced riders. For new riders, I recommend the smaller R3 as a safer option.

Is a R6 comfortable to ride?

Is the Yamaha R6 Comfortable? The Yamaha R6 is not comfortable due to its high pegs, low handlebars, and seating position. Comfort has been sacrificed for performance and optimum aerodynamics, forcing the rider to adopt a bent-over riding position. Some owners report wrist discomfort at lower speeds.

Is the R6 faster than the R7?

The most obvious difference between the Yamaha YZF-R6 and the YZF-R7 is the engine. The R6 has an inline four-cylinder engine with a huge top-end rush of torque and a redline north of 15,000 rpm. Racers will keep it screaming above 9,000 rpm most of the time to get the most out of the peak torque.

When did the R6 get abs?

The 2008 bike remained unchanged until it was replaced by the 2017 R6, which gained a new R1-style look, an advanced electronics package that includes traction control and ABS and new suspension.

Will Yamaha bring the R6 back?

The Yamaha YZF-R6 is back for 2022, though not for road use. Meet the 2022 Yamaha YZF-R6 GYTR, a track-only motorcycle stripped of DOT and EPA requirements and festooned with trick parts from the GYTR catalog.

Is the R6 discontinued?

Yamaha USA has announced the 2020 model year will be the last for the Yamaha YZF-R6, as the model will be discontinued in the USA and Europe.
